Job Description
The Part-Time Preschool Assistant Teacher plays a vital role in supporting classroom instruction and
providing trauma-informed behavioral guidance. This position works closely with the Lead
Teacher and Children’s Program team to build a structured, loving environment where children
feel seen, safe, and supported.

Hours: Tuesdays and Thursdays, 5:30-8:30 PM

Classroom Support & Student Engagement

  • Assist with leading group activities and play-based learning experiences.
  • Support individual children during emotional or behavioral challenges using calm,
    trauma-informed responses.
  • Help implement behavioral support plans and reinforce classroom expectations.

Behavioral Support

  •  Encourage positive peer interactions and model appropriate social behaviors.
  • Provide consistent and compassionate support during transitions, routines, and group
    time.
  • Assist with de-escalation techniques and redirection when needed.

Team Colaboration

  • Work in partnership with the Lead Teacher and Children’s Program Coordinator to
    maintain a cohesive classroom culture.
  • Share observations on children’s behavior and progress to inform support strategies.
  • Participate in staff meetings, planning sessions, and training as needed.

Required Skills/Abilities:

  •  Associate degree in Early Childhood Education, Child Development, Psychology, Social
    Work, or a related field.
  • Minimum of 1 year of experience working with children in behavioral management,
    special education, or trauma-informed environments.
  • Strong understanding of behavioral management techniques, trauma-informed care, and
    childhood development.
  • Ability to work with children from diverse backgrounds and adapt approaches to meet
    each child’s unique needs.
  • Excellent interpersonal and communication skills, with a collaborative and empathetic
    approach.
